我买kinect回来之后,就去官网下载了SDK驱动。
如今想用processing和OpenNI做东西,于是我按照这个帖http://www.douban.com/group/topic/27931394/一步步安装。
processing下载的是2.0,接着下载了OpenNI_NITE_Installer-Win32-0.26,和SimpleOpenNI-0.26。
解压后我先安装了OpenNI,再安装了NITE的,包括nite-win32-1.5.2.21-dev,openni-win32-1.5.2.23-dev,SensorKinect091-Bin-Win32-v5.1.0.25,sensor-win32-5.1.0.41-redist。
重启电脑后,打开计算机属性的设备管理器
没有出现PrimeSense这个驱动,只有Kinect for Windows。也就是说我的SensorKinect驱动没有安装成功。
于是我去试OpenNI是否安装成功,把SimpleOpenNI 0.26 解压放进了C:\Users\我的名字\Documents\Processing\libraries里。从processing的library也导入了OpenNI。输入别人编辑好的代码后,会报错,说我C盘目录下SimpleOpenNI32.dll的文件缺失。